#e591cd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e591cd is composed of 89.8% red, 56.9%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.7% magenta, 10.5%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 317.1 degrees, a saturation of 61.8% and a lightness of 73.3%. #e591cd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cb239b.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

● #e591cd color description : Very soft pink.
#e591cd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e591cd has RGB values of R:229, G:145,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.1,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15045069.

Shades and Tints of #e591cd
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#fcf0f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e591cd
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bbbbbb is the less saturated color, while #fa7cd6 is the most saturated one.
